Dioryctria rubella Hampson belongs to Lepidoptera which Lepidoptera Pyralidae Dioryctria genus Dioryctria. Is one of the most important insect pests from distribution from Yunnan to Northeast China. Hylobitelus xiaoi Zhang is the type of pest in recent years China's forestry outbreak of trunk.Study on damage investigate in masson pine(Pinus massoniana Lamb) seed orchard in Qiannan area at 2013~2015, The most important borers is Dioryctria rublla Hampison and Hylobitelus xiaoi Zhang of we found. Through a comprehensive investigation and station observation, observation record habit?damage mode and harm for crown height of diverse by masson pine, the result that:1. Dioryctria rublla Hampison in Guizhou province has 3 generations a year, hazard ratio was 100%. The larvae insect harm for annual main shoots or side shoots of masson pine. The phenomenon of the shoot tip for harm was nearly 90 degree bend or spiral bending, the place of crooked with resin flow phenomenon, lead to exsciccation and crown deformity of main shoots or side shoots. Serious impact growth and yield of masson pine. A few of larvae could harm for biennial cones, lead to great influence for harvest.2. Dioryctria rubella in masson pine seed orchard harm rate is 100% at Guizhou Qiannan area. From April to Jun is the damage peak period. The percentage of injury on the top of the canopy is the most serious.3. Indoor temperature 30~28 degrees Celsius, the relative humidity of 90% to 80% of the conditions, the duration of the Dioryctria rublla egg is 5 to 8 days, average 6 days,larval stage 30 to 45 days, average 37 days, pupa period is 12 to 16 days, average 14 days. Female after spawning life expectancy is 4 to 7 days, average 5 days; Male 3 to 6 days, average 4 days.4. Annual harm most seriously is the first generation of Dioryctria rublla, the greatest harm generation Masson growth. The occurrence regularity of the pine shoot was closely related to the season, the length of growth and the degree of lignin. The growth and damage of the larvae were closely related to the local environmental factors, which showed a high selectivity and synchronization. Adults have phototaxis, could adopt the method of prevention of light induced killing.5. To investigate the damage of forest by Hylobitelus xiaoi. Forest average murder rate was 52.4%, belongs to the serious harm, the central and southern mbrosia forest edge length was significantly higher than that of the western edge, the vertical height of mbrosia in northern forest edge was significantly lower than the other 4 range of mbrosia height.6. In the direction of the choice is more likely direction which has more sun radiation of Hylobitelus xiaoi. In the northern forest edge and central forest have minimum sunshine radiation, The choice of insect channel orientation is more close to random distribution.
